146. To ask the Minister for Public Expenditure and Reform the progress in establishing an interdepartmental group to examine the issue of those who are forced to retire at 65 years of age but who are not eligible for a State pension until they reach 66 years of age, as he indicated in correspondence dated 24 November 2015; and if he will make a statement on the matter. In January the Government approved the establishment of an Interdepartmental Working Group to consider policy that will support fuller working lives. The Group is chaired by an Assistant Secretary from my Department and includes senior level representatives from the Departments of Jobs, Enterprise and Innovation, Social Protection, Justice, Health and Education.

The Group is presently examining all of the relevant issues and has been engaging with stakeholders.  The intention remains to report back to Government towards the end of the second quarter this year.
